Wonewoc is a village located in Juneau County, Wisconsin. Wonewoc has a 2025 population of 722. Wonewoc is currently declining at a rate of -1.1% annually and its population has decreased by -5.12% since the most recent census, which recorded a population of 761 in 2020.
The average household income in Wonewoc is $81,472 with a poverty rate of 15.34%.The median age in Wonewoc is 39.7 years: 28.6 years for males, and 49.6 years for females.

The racial composition of Wonewoc includes 76.12% White, and smaller percentages for Asian, Native American, Black or African American and multiracial populations.
Race | Population | Percentage (of total) |
---|---|---|
White | 526 | 76.12% |
Two or more races | 140 | 20.26% |
Asian | 12 | 1.74% |
Native American | 10 | 1.45% |
Black or African American | 3 | 0.43% |

Wonewoc's average per capita income is $50,357. Household income levels show a median of $75,069. The poverty rate stands at 15.34%.
Name | Median | Mean |
---|---|---|
Married Families | $108,750 | - |
Families | $90,625 | $93,340 |
Households | $75,069 | $81,472 |
Non Families | $38,750 | $49,924 |
